The active ingredient of marijuana is tetrahydrocannabinol (THC)which is responsible for causing change in the brain.
This activates specific receptors called cannabinoid receptor.This receptors are found in limbic and cerebral cortex region and cerebellum.
As these receptors are located in the brain, the effect of these receptors are also wide spread.In healthy brain, these receptors are activated by a neurotransmitter called as anandamide that have pain relieving effect and also play important function in brain.When THC activates these receptors,causes interference of the normal function.
marijuana also boost another type of neurotransmitter called dopamine after taking the drug.
